On April 27, 2014, a Bellanca Super Viking 17-30A (N9759E) crashed near Avenger Field Airport, Sweetwater, Texas, after the pilot reported fuel exhaustion. The pilot suffered minor injuries; the passenger was fatally injured.

History of Flight

On April 27, 2014, about 1453 central daylight time, a Bellanca Super Viking 17-30A, N9759E, was substantially damaged when it impacted terrain near Avenger Field Airport (SWW), Sweetwater, Texas. The airplane had departed from Shreveport Regional Airport (SHV), Shreveport, Louisiana, about 1140. Visual meteorological conditions prevailed and an instrument flight rules flight plan was filed. The commercial pilot received minor injuries and the passenger was fatally injured. The personal flight was conducted under 14 Code of Federal Regulations Part 91.

According to the Nolan County Sheriff's officer who responded, the pilot stated he had run out of fuel. The pilot explained the airplane had three fuel tanks and when he attempted to switch tanks, the engine stalled and could not be restarted. The pilot also noted the flight was windy and rough.

Aircraft Information

The airplane, manufactured in 1974, was a 4-seat, low-wing, retractable-gear airplane, serial number 75-30762, powered by a Continental Motors IO-520-K1B engine rated at 300 horsepower, driving a metal, 3-blade McCauley D3A34C401-C constant-speed propeller. The most recent annual inspection was completed on July 1, 2013, at a Hobbs time of 4,081.39 hours. The aircraft total time at the accident was unknown.

The airplane was equipped with seven fuel tanks: three in each wing and one auxiliary in the fuselage. The wing tanks held a total of 34 gallons, with 30 gallons useable. The auxiliary tank held 15 gallons.

Wreckage and Impact

The main wreckage was located at N32°30.572' W100°24.321 in a ravine, resting inverted with the nose at the bottom and the tail rising out. Flight control continuity was verified. The engine remained partially attached with all four mount legs broken. The exhaust system was crushed upward. The propeller remained attached; two blades were bent aft, and the third was relatively straight with a slight bend.

Fuel system inspection revealed no fuel in the lines except for the metered pressure gauge line. Approximately 4 gallons of 100 low lead aviation fuel was drained from the left, right, and auxiliary tanks. No fuel spillage or blighting was present. The landing gear was stowed and the gear switch was in the UP position. Cockpit examination showed the fuel mixture control in rich, throttle ¼ from full, fuel selector in LEFT position, master switch ON, ignition OFF, fuel pump OFF, flaps at zero, autopilot ON, and ELT ARMED. No evidence of mechanical malfunctions that would have precluded normal operation was found.

Additional Information

The pilot reported all tanks were topped off in SHV. He typically used only one wing's tanks for the trip but expected higher fuel consumption due to headwinds. He checked winds at 6,000 and 9,000 feet: 30 and 35 knots from 200°, respectively. He had never flown the route in such a headwind. His typical fuel management: auxiliary tank lasting 45 minutes to an hour, wing tanks about 2.5 hours each, kept selected for about 2 hours. He believed the airplane would fly safely for 4 hours and 45 minutes with reserve.

The Bellanca Viking 300A Pilot Operating Handbook states the auxiliary fuel pump has OFF, LOW, and PRIME positions; PRIME should be used only for starting or restoring lost fuel flow. The Airplane Flight Manual states: if a tank is run dry, switch to a tank with ample fuel and hold the boost pump on PRIME; the auxiliary pump must be on to ensure fuel flow, and an air restart should occur in less than 10 seconds. The pilot did not use the fuel boost pump during his attempted restart, stating he did not need it based on past experience and thought it might flood the engine.

The passenger, the pilot's wife, typically wore only the lap belt and was reclined sleeping with only the lap belt fastened when on final approach; the pilot woke her but she remained lying down.

GPS Data

A Garmin GPSMAP 396 unit recovered from the wreckage showed the airplane flew from SHV to the accident location in 3 hours 12 minutes over 361.4 nautical miles. The flight departed SHV around 11:40, climbed to about 8,300 feet, and cruised west-southwest with ground speeds varying 100-165 knots. Descent began around 14:36 from about 7,000 feet. The last data point at 14:53:00 showed the aircraft at 2,316 feet, 53 knots, about 1.40 nautical miles northwest of Runway 22 threshold.

Fuel Selector Examination

The fuel selector unit was examined at the NTSB Materials Laboratory. The detent balls seated securely in each detent position. Wear was observed in the cadmium plating between detent positions, but no indication of gross material spalling, galling, or corrosion was noted.
